The reaction of allenes with phosphorus(III) compounds bearing a P-NH-(t-Bu) group: isolation of both enantiomers in crystalline form from an achiral system

https://doi.org/10.1016/j.tetlet.2008.09.153Get rights and content

Abstract

Structural characterization of the tautomeric forms of the zwitterions proposed in the phosphine catalyzed transformations of electron-deficient allenes by utilizing a cyclodiphosphazane with a P-NH-t-Bu group and Ph2P(NH-t-Bu) is described. Spontaneous resolution of the products (R and S enantiomers of the crystals) via crystallization is highlighted.
